  1. I've used a cheap metal detector (RatShack mid-model) on a railroad bed (abandoned) and right of way margins, and found it even more frustrating than searches in a park. Instead of just cans, pop-tops, and foil wrappers you also find liberally sprinkled spikes, bolts, washers, and other unrecognizable hardware when you are lucky. When you are unlucky you get a batch of iron-bearing slag that was used for ballast, irregularly distributed so you get changing readings everywhere you look.

     

    Maybe the nonferrous discrimination is better on the expensive units, but the problem is still formidable if you have an area of many yards to search.

    The station BLACK you were originally seeking is set up like a triangulation station, although it is just listed as "survey disk". Tri stations typically have 2 reference marks nearby, and an azimuth/reference mark perhaps a quarter mile away (this one uses a landmark instead of an azimuth disk). The reference marks are most often along a road right of way and can often be found without too much trouble.

     

    BLACK is a newer style mark, on a deep rod, and is buried. The "surface mark" for the older (1930's) tri stations around here is usually buried 12 to 20 inches in a cultivated field. The REAL mark, which even the NGS doesn't look at except for the most serious work, is about 4 feet deeper, with the surface mark carefully aligned over it.

     

    To claim a find on a station, you need to find the surface mark, not just the reference marks, and I haven't been digging them up due to the bother of finding the right person to ask permission from. It is quite useful, however, to report on the condition and coordinates of the reference marks, and the sky visibility of the probable station location.

  8. Early in this thread, there was mention of the large discrepancies seen in scaled coordinates. Scaled means somebody plotted it by description on a map and then used a scale to read the Lat Long values.

     

    I plot the difference between the listed and my measured coordinates for the marks of a given era I find in a given county, and find the average offset. Then when looking for another mark of that type, I apply that offset to the listed coordinates so I start closer to the right place. It can mean the difference in picking the right culvert or unnamed cross street.

     

    Locally the 1930's marks tend to be found 150 feet NW of the published values. Despite the 6 second tolerance quoted, I have found the majority of the marks to be within a little more than plus or minus one second, after adjusting with this offset. The offset changes significantly around the state, and then occasionally you get the zinger that is off the full 6 seconds.

     

    Pay close attention to the date of the mark and whether it is scaled or adjusted. Triangulation and intersection stations are adjusted, and will almost always be within handheld GPS accuracy. Newer marks will often be scaled from a more accurate map than the old ones.

  10. I would also suggest reporting the sky visibility for satellite measurements, relative to the NGS standard which I think is "clear from 15 degrees above the horizon in all directions, except for a few isolated small obstructions".

     

    To report to the NGS using the on-line form, you have to check "Yes" or "No" about this so it is a good idea to have the info in the Groundspeak entry also. I tend to err on the "favorable" side when selecting Yes/No but may mention "marginal visibility to the south" in the comments if I'm unsure. Better to have the pros drive by and say "I don't like that site" than to make a possible candidate fall off their list.

  13. I would agree that the mark is not under the paving that is referred to. But it very well could be underground or under newer paving.

     

    It might even have been intentionally buried. This is a horizontal control station. In my area nearly all of the horizontal stations (triangulation stations) set in the 1930's to 1950's are buried.

     

    They have a "surface mark" typically 18 inches down in soil (not too many rocks available here) and the true mark about 4 feet lower. They are a disk in a concrete post sitting on top of another disk in a post with careful alignment to keep one precisely over the other. When you look for them, you only find the reference marks. If you can't see the (buried) surface mark you can't log a find on GC.com.
